    reviewer2695221

Handles large data efficiently with secure and quick change management

  • April 15, 2025
  • Review provided by PeerSpot

What is our primary use case?

Tableau can process a huge amount of data, which is one of my main criteria. Another significant feature is change management. Enhancements to existing dashboards or reports can be made quickly. The security of Tableau is also pretty good.

What is most valuable?

Tableau's ability to handle integration and the stability of the tool itself are the most valuable features. It can process a huge amount of data. Multiple sources can be connected to Tableau, and meaningful insights can be derived. Tableau serves as a stable dashboarding tool for higher management, aiding in quick decision-making.

What needs improvement?

The look and feel of the tool itself, including the dashboard features and data visualization, could be improved. The graphs in Tableau also have room for improvement.

For how long have I used the solution?

I have around three to four years of experience using Tableau.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

I would rate the stability of Tableau as nine out of ten.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

I would rate the scalability of Tableau as around eight to nine.

How are customer service and support?

I would rate the technical support at around eight to nine.

How would you rate customer service and support?

Positive

How was the initial setup?

The initial setup of Tableau is straightforward. Tableau can be downloaded for free from the Tableau website, and it can be installed on a desktop for self-service design.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

I am not directly involved in the pricing of Tableau, so I am not sure about the pricing, setup cost, or licensing.

Which other solutions did I evaluate?

The competitors of Tableau are MicroStrategy and Power BI.

What other advice do I have?

I would recommend using Tableau, but there are other competitors like MicroStrategy and Power BI. The choice depends on the organization. If I were to rate Tableau, I would give it around an eight out of ten.

    reviewer1293936

Gain clarity in financial presentations and face challenges with data preparation

  • April 14, 2025
  • Review provided by PeerSpot

What is our primary use case?

We mainly use Tableau for financial presentations.

What is most valuable?

Tableau is extremely good at dashboard creation, providing clear and concise visual presentations. The most beneficial feature is its ability to present data cleanly and effectively. However, setting it up and using it with large datasets can be challenging. Tableau excels in visualization, making presentations efficient.

What needs improvement?

I find data prepping in Tableau challenging to understand, perhaps because I am new to it. It sometimes requires extensive investigation to determine why the data does not appear correctly. Currently, I rely on community support to answer my queries, and it is still early for me to provide further comments on improvement.

For how long have I used the solution?

I have been using Tableau for less than a year.

What was my experience with deployment of the solution?

There were challenges in getting accustomed to the functionality of Tableau, especially since I am used to Microsoft products. Certain criteria needed a lot of experimentation, particularly in data prepping. Sometimes the data doesn't appear as expected, leading to extensive investigative work.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

I have not faced any issues with the stability of Tableau.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

I am still working towards understanding the scalability of Tableau. Currently, I have not encountered any limitations, but I am still exploring and replacing current tools. It is too early to comment on scalability issues.

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We previously used Microsoft Power BI. Power BI seems more powerful for data massaging and processing compared to Tableau. However, Tableau is superior in terms of visualization.

How was the initial setup?

The initial setup was a bit challenging, particularly because I was used to Microsoft products. It took some time to get certain criteria right, but it has become easier over time.

What about the implementation team?

The setup was conducted through my IT team, who provided me with the license.

What was our ROI?

We have not derived any significant benefits yet as we are still in the exploration stage, except for one time-saving achievement.

What other advice do I have?

If you have many presentations, I recommend Tableau. However, if your focus is on heavy data processing or data prepping, Tableau may not be the best choice. I would rate Tableau a 7 out of 10.
